## Runbook: Account Recovery — Spokeshift Rebalancer

When a dispatcher is locked out of Spokeshift, first confirm their identity against the staff roster and verify the lockout in the audit log. Do not simply reset the password; use the formal recovery flow so fleet assignments are preserved. The recovery flow requires the operations passphrase at the second prompt. Handle it carefully and never paste it into tickets or chat. For contractors performing recovery, the passphrase is recorded here:

vault phrase of fawif-haduf = wenwyn-briath

Offline Mode — Plugin Notes

When FieldTrace enters offline mode, plugin hooks fire against the local queue, not the live sync layer. Writes are journaled and replayed on reconnect, so plugins must be idempotent on record upserts. Do not assume ordering across survey sessions. Conflict resolution defaults to last-writer-wins unless a plugin registers a merge handler. Full hook lifecycle diagrams and replay semantics are documented on the internal page here.

operations page: https://jenkins.zemvarcloud.local/job/merge_requests/repo/build/73930b4b30f0a8ed

/*
 * Stitchkit component library — version resolver client.
 * Queries the Ledgerline registry for the pinned Stitchkit
 * release per consuming app. Do not bump major versions here;
 * that's handled by the release train. The resolver
 * authenticates to Ledgerline with the internal key below.
 */

gateway credential: qvz15-KH6w5OvQFD1Z8FT

Action item: The Relayn deploy-status bot silently dropped updates when the pipeline API paginated results, so responders believed a rollback had completed when it had not. We will add pagination handling, a staleness banner, and an integration test. Until merged, verify deploy state directly in the pipeline console, documented at the page below.

runbook for kahop-kajop: https://rundeck.ordinio.test/display/secrets/pipeline/issue/pages/repo/browse/e5732776e07d1285107e5aeb